Description
Bar Plata is a small, traditional bar and cafetería in the heart of Palma, celebrated for its llonguets – the classic Mallorcan bread roll sandwiches – and its genuine local character.
Llonguets, coffee and more
The star of the show at Bar Plata is the llonguet: a small sandwich made with locally baked bread rolls, served cold or warm, filled with freshly carved ham or other ingredients and prepared right in front of you. Alongside these come a proper café con leche – sometimes served in a glass – and freshly squeezed orange juice. Cold beer, at times poured from a frosted jug, rounds things off nicely.
Authentic and family-run
Bar Plata is a family-run establishment that has held on to its traditional character throughout the years. The atmosphere is straightforward, unpretentious and unmistakably local – a welcome contrast to the more tourist-oriented surroundings. Service is warm and attentive, and the prices are very reasonable.
Right in the centre of Palma
The bar is located at Carrer de l'Argenteria 1 in the Centre district of Palma. The entrance is step-free and fully accessible.
A farewell on the horizon
According to the Diario de Mallorca, the family behind Bar Plata plans to close the bar at the end of 2026, bringing to an end decades of family ownership. If you want to experience Bar Plata in its original form, it's well worth making the trip sooner rather than later.
